Mamhoodpur

Mamhoodpur is a village located in Misrikh tehsil of Sitapur district in Uttar Pradesh, India. Sitapur and Misrikh are the district & sub-district headquarters of Mamhoodpur village respectively. As per 2009 stats, Surjanpur is the gram panchayat of Mamhoodpur village.

About Mamhoodpur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Mamhoodpur is 137172. The village spans a total geographical area of 30.14 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 261404. Sitapur is nearest town to Mamhoodpur village for all major economic activities.

Population of Mamhoodpur

According to the 2011 Census, Mamhoodpur has a total population of about 251, with approximately 133 males and 118 females. The sex ratio is around 887 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 28 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 199 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 52.99%, with male literacy at about 59.40% and female literacy near 45.76%. There are around 55 households in the village. Connectivity of Mamhoodpur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Mamhoodpur. As per the 2011 stats, Mamhoodpur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
